1. Start with the Basics: Understanding the Fundamentals

Before diving into complex algorithms or advanced frameworks, it’s crucial to build a strong foundation. This includes understanding basic programming concepts such as variables, loops, conditionals, and data structures. Languages like Python, JavaScript, or Java are often recommended for beginners due to their readability and widespread use.

  • Why it matters: A solid grasp of the basics will make it easier to learn more advanced topics later on.
  • Actionable tip: Start with a beginner-friendly language and work through introductory tutorials or online courses.

2. Practice, Practice, Practice: The Key to Mastery

Software development is a skill that improves with practice. Writing code regularly helps reinforce what you’ve learned and exposes you to real-world problems that require creative solutions.

  • Why it matters: Practical experience is invaluable; it helps you understand how theoretical concepts apply in real-world scenarios.
  • Actionable tip: Set aside time each day to code, even if it’s just for 30 minutes. Work on small projects or contribute to open-source initiatives.

3. Learn by Doing: Build Projects

One of the most effective ways to learn software development is by building projects. Whether it’s a simple to-do list app or a more complex web application, working on projects allows you to apply what you’ve learned and gain hands-on experience.

  • Why it matters: Projects help you understand the entire development process, from planning and design to implementation and debugging.
  • Actionable tip: Start with small, manageable projects and gradually increase the complexity as you become more comfortable.

4. Understand the Importance of Algorithms and Data Structures

Algorithms and data structures are the backbone of software development. They help you write efficient, scalable code and solve complex problems.

  • Why it matters: A strong understanding of algorithms and data structures is often required in technical interviews and is essential for writing high-performance applications.
  • Actionable tip: Study common algorithms (e.g., sorting, searching) and data structures (e.g., arrays, linked lists, trees) and practice implementing them in your preferred programming language.

5. Version Control: Learn Git and GitHub

Version control is an essential tool for any developer. Git, in particular, is widely used for tracking changes in code and collaborating with others.

  • Why it matters: Version control allows you to manage your codebase effectively, collaborate with other developers, and revert to previous versions if something goes wrong.
  • Actionable tip: Learn the basics of Git, such as committing changes, branching, and merging. Create a GitHub account to host your projects and collaborate with others.

6. Read Code: Learn from Others

Reading other people’s code is a great way to learn new techniques, understand different coding styles, and see how experienced developers solve problems.

  • Why it matters: Exposure to different coding styles and solutions can broaden your understanding and improve your own coding practices.
  • Actionable tip: Explore open-source projects on GitHub or other platforms. Try to understand how the code works and consider contributing to the project.

8. Networking: Connect with Other Developers

Networking with other developers can provide valuable insights, mentorship, and job opportunities. It also allows you to share knowledge and learn from others’ experiences.

  • Why it matters: Building a professional network can open doors to new opportunities and provide support throughout your career.
  • Actionable tip: Attend meetups, conferences, or online webinars. Join developer communities on platforms like LinkedIn or Discord.

9. Soft Skills: Communication and Teamwork

While technical skills are essential, soft skills like communication, teamwork, and problem-solving are equally important in software development. These skills help you collaborate effectively with others and navigate the complexities of team-based projects.

  • Why it matters: Soft skills are crucial for working in teams, managing projects, and communicating your ideas effectively.
  • Actionable tip: Practice clear and concise communication, both written and verbal. Participate in team projects or pair programming sessions to improve your collaboration skills.

10. Continuous Learning: Never Stop Improving

Software development is a field that requires continuous learning. New technologies, tools, and methodologies are constantly emerging, and staying ahead requires a commitment to lifelong learning.

  • Why it matters: Continuous learning ensures that your skills remain relevant and that you’re able to adapt to new challenges and opportunities.
  • Actionable tip: Dedicate time each week to learning something new, whether it’s a new programming language, a new framework, or a new development methodology.

FAQs

Q1: What is the best programming language for beginners? A1: Python is often recommended for beginners due to its simplicity and readability. However, the best language depends on your goals and the type of projects you want to work on.

Q2: How long does it take to learn software development? A2: The time it takes to learn software development varies depending on your background, dedication, and the complexity of the skills you want to acquire. It could take anywhere from a few months to several years.

Q3: Do I need a degree to become a software developer? A3: While a degree can be helpful, it’s not always necessary. Many successful developers are self-taught or have learned through online courses and practical experience.

Q4: How important is math in software development? A4: Math is important in certain areas of software development, such as algorithms, data science, and game development. However, many developers work in areas where advanced math is not required.

Q5: What are some good resources for learning software development? A5: Some popular resources include online platforms like Codecademy, freeCodeCamp, and Coursera, as well as books like “Eloquent JavaScript” and “Clean Code.”
